Alfa Romeo concept

First post here, just found this forum and lots of good work so far so I thought I'd share mine. It's still very much a WIP and is for a school project, and lots of parts and details aren't modelled or are temporary (such as the wheels/interior).









Influences are a little bit Alfa, TVR, Jaguar, etc. Aim was for more of a classic design, and I'm pretty happy with it. Have to start modelling the smaller details. The interior is temporary, and probably won't be finished, just there for a bit more realism.

I still need alot of work on the lighting/materials too. But compared to the rest of my class it's miles above so I'm not too worried.

Thanks. I think the wheel size might be throwing you off a bit and making the car seem smaller then it really is. Proportionwise the car is almost identical to a Ferrari 612 Scaglietti. The rims on there right now are gigantic and completely tucked into the fenders, which make it feel a bit smaller. I think once I work on that itll help the proportion a bit.

Thanks for the kind words though. This was my first real project that got to a completed stage, and also my first time working with Sub-Division surfaces, shaders, rendering and a bunch of other features in Maya that I've never touched before.

Hopefully next week I'll have more time to work on the lighting and materials. Have to have this finished up by the 1st week of May when the Semester ends.

Now my biggest worry is getting the wheel/tire to look realistic.

Some progress after a few weeks of nothing. Trying to the small things dialed in at this point, namely the materials/lighting. I seem to get the materials the way I like, but then I need to change the lighting and it messes up the materials again. I think the new lighting setup is working a bit better. Some other small stuff added like wheels/brakes.















Need to hand this in on Tuesday, so at this point other then a few small quick details like the wipers and such, it's pretty close to done. I had a much nicer displacement map on the tire but it started killing my render times and the one I have now sucks, but is fast. I'll change that at the very end when I'm doing the final renders. I may go back and touch things up later on, but I think theres a good chance I may just use this for a base on my next model and start the rest fresh. Still a pretty good finished product for my first time I think.
